I'm an Applied Mathematician from Neustadt

I am located in Neustadt an der Weinstraße. I am an expert in mathematical image processing and on how to use images to learn more about complex materials.

I currently work on motion estimation from timeseries of 3D images. My focus is on the applicability to large datasets of several hundreds of GB and on application to sparse and discontinuous materials.

Research
My research focuses on image processing for materials science. In my PhD, I investigated motion estimation for in situ material tests. Since recently, I focus on deducing materials laws from image based data. I have a diverse background in mathematics, ranging from inverse problems over partial differential equations and variational methods to differential geometry. As I always focused on applied mathematics, I have rich experience in implementing solution algorithms for manifold problems in mathematics.
